Pack the Park Fun Run Saturday May 10, 2025 has live music, a food truck, and supports good causes

Shoreline, WALocal News

The Pack the Park Fun Run, entering its ninth year, will occur on May 10, 2025, at Pfingst Animal Acres Park, Lake Forest Park. Originally a PTA initiative, it has evolved into a cherished community event managed by Kind + Co Events, which operates at no cost, relying on volunteer support. This year's festivities will feature live music from the Lago Vista Social Club band, food trucks, and snow cones, creating a vibrant atmosphere for participants. Proceeds will benefit the Lake Forest Park Farmers Market Bucks and the Shoreline Schools Angel Fund, both crucial for supporting local families in need. The Farmers Market Bucks program helps families access fresh, local produce, while the Angel Fund addresses school lunch debt to ensure no child goes hungry.

Community involvement is encouraged through registration, volunteering, or sponsorship to maximize the event's positive effects. Donations will also be accepted for those who cannot attend, directly aiding local families. The event emphasizes community spirit and the importance of giving back.
